Master Style PCL (BKK:MASTER)
Thailand flag Thailand · Delayed Price · Currency is THB
9.75
+0.40 (4.28%)
Feb 10, 2026, 4:36 PM ICT

Master Style PCL Ratios and Metrics

Millions THB.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
2,94213,65215,312---
Market Cap Growth
-79.26%-10.84%----
Enterprise Value
3,51213,80513,540---
Last Close Price
9.7543.9749.30---
PE Ratio
7.7726.1336.78---
Forward PE
12.0923.5931.55---
PS Ratio
1.436.337.88---
PB Ratio
0.863.895.12---
P/TBV Ratio
0.873.905.13---
P/FCF Ratio
9.16275.13----
P/OCF Ratio
6.4125.8233.12---
EV/Sales Ratio
1.706.406.97---
EV/EBITDA Ratio
5.4919.3423.57---
EV/EBIT Ratio
7.1923.0525.80---
EV/FCF Ratio
10.94278.21----
Debt / Equity Ratio
0.190.200.100.760.890.54
Debt / EBITDA Ratio
1.070.960.500.730.610.71
Debt / FCF Ratio
1.9913.99-1.650.720.83
Asset Turnover
0.500.530.851.931.26-
Inventory Turnover
8.287.749.6314.4213.48-
Quick Ratio
0.190.435.041.001.082.16
Current Ratio
0.710.735.381.331.192.35
Return on Equity (ROE)
11.32%16.07%24.52%105.51%78.45%-
Return on Assets (ROA)
6.69%9.18%14.31%31.20%24.18%-
Return on Invested Capital (ROIC)
9.12%17.66%41.74%129.72%198.14%81.47%
Return on Capital Employed (ROCE)
11.50%14.80%16.00%55.30%67.70%42.90%
Earnings Yield
12.88%3.83%2.72%---
FCF Yield
10.91%0.36%-1.85%---
Dividend Yield
8.56%1.82%0.04%---
Payout Ratio
63.70%0.80%17.94%138.25%62.04%-
Buyback Yield / Dilution
0.00%-0.87%-35.02%-74.48%-18.62%-896.89%
Total Shareholder Return
9.04%0.95%-34.97%-74.48%-18.62%-896.89%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.